A shopping area in Whitchurch has been put up for sale and is expected to cost £1.1 million.

Bredwood Arcade, which links Green End and the High Street with Tesco and White Lion Meadow, is on the market with GVA, which describes the stretch of shops as an opportunity to acquire a fully-refurbished high street retail arcade, situated in a convenient and popular location.

The 15,519 sq ft Arcade has 14 retail units and two office suites which includes High Street names Superdrug, Card Factory and Thomas Cook among the current occupiers.

The arcade provides a busy link for pedestrians from Tesco and adjoining car parks with the rest of the town centre.

The company added the site is located close to the junction of High Street and Watergate Street, and is a short walk from the railway station.

David Winterbottom, from GVA, said: “We are pleased to be instructed to market the investment of Bredwood Arcade.

“Whitchurch is thriving and the arcade is popular with shoppers because of its range of shops and convenient location.

“A traditional market town, Whitchurch is a focal point for the surrounding affluent farming community and we’re confident this site will receive significant interest.”
